What to check before for buildings near the M4 bus in NYC

  • Use the M4-focused filter to target locations first, then compare building basics like doorman, laundry, parking, and package handling based on each building’s page.
  • Check what’s actually available right now and confirm unit details (floor, exposure, layout, and start date) before applying.
  • Expect that building rules can vary: ask about lease terms, guest policy, and any restrictions that affect your plans (especially if you commute often).
  • If the building lists fees or deposits, verify the full move-in cost with the landlord or manager (deposit, broker fee if applicable, and any recurring utility expectations).
  • Compare Openigloo signals across options, but treat them as leads—final terms come from the building’s current management and lease paperwork.
